This Burmese amber specimen contains a remarkably preserved wasp inclusion, suspended with exceptional clarity within rich, golden Cretaceous resin. The insect’s body structure, wings, and prominently visible eyes are sharply defined, offering a rare and detailed glimpse into prehistoric life nearly 100 million years ago. The transparency of the amber allows light to pass through and highlight the wasp’s intricate features, enhancing its lifelike appearance and visual impact. This outstanding specimen combines scientific importance with natural beauty, making it a prized addition to any amber or fossil collection.

Details

• Approximately 100 million years old

• Origin. Hukawng Valley, Burma

• Period. Cretaceous amber, time of the dinosaurs

• Inclusions. Wasp with visible eyes
